Since its first edition in 1985, Patrick McNeill's "Research
Methods" has become a classic introductory text for undergraduate
students of sociology and for a range of specialists in disciplines
such as education, business, social care, and medicine who need a
brief but authoritative account of how sociologists set about doing
research.
